Spike TV gets reruns of 'The Shield'

LOS ANGELES, July 18 (UPI) -- The U.S. cable network, Spike TV, Monday acquired the rerun rights of the FX series "The Shield" from Sony Pictures Television.

Spike TV -- billed as the first network for men -- will start running the popular series from its beginning starting in March 2006, officials announced Monday.

"The Shield" won a Golden Globe Award for Best Drama Series in 2003 and received two 2005 Emmy nominations.

Robert Friedman, Spike TV senior vice president of programming, said "The Shield" complement's the network's "male-branded strategy."

Spike TV is available in 88 million U.S. homes and is a division of MTV Networks.
